> Folks, > As we promised in February, we start to sell > eBusinessID certificates to resellers. I have to say that I am very disappointed with the course Geotrust appears to have decided to take. Here was a company with the perfect opportunity to shake up the SSL Cert market, and they instead have become really no better than any other's in the business with their excessively high pricing for a service that really should be priced under $75 retail to the end user. Now they have set the QuickSSL product at $119 retail, and the eBusinessID product at $199 retail. That eBusinessID product was a $75 product when Equifax had it. Someone needs to get in and shake this market up. Instead they come in with low prices to draw in the initial sales, and then capitalize themselves on the artificially inflated prices the virtual monopolies have permitted to occur. I think the pricing changes were a very bad move for Geotrust. -- Best regards, William X Walsh <[EMAIL PROTECTED]> -- OpenSRS installation and customizations Payment Processing Integration Apache Installation and Support Services http://www.wxsoft.com/
